The cheapest way to get from Mijas to Casares is to bus via Marbella Ricardo Soriano which costs €10 - €19 and takes 4h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Mijas to Casares is to drive which takes 1h 5m and costs €12 - €18.
No, there is no direct bus from Mijas to Casares. However, there are services departing from Mijas El Ciprés and arriving at Casares via Fuengirola and Sabinillas Centro.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 3m.
The distance between Mijas and Casares is 94 km. The road distance is 77.9 km.
The best way to get from Mijas to Casares without a car is to bus which takes 4h 3m and costs €11 - €19.
It takes approximately 4h 3m to get from Mijas to Casares, including transfers.
